What is the difference between Weekend Business Analytics vs Weekend Data Analysis?

AspectWeekend Business AnalyticsWeekend Data Analysis
Required CredentialsBachelor's in Business, Analytics, or related field; often certifications in analytics toolsBachelor's in Data Science, Statistics, or related field; similar certifications in data tools
Work EnvironmentBusiness offices, consulting firms, or remote settings focusing on strategic insightsData-focused environments, labs, or remote work analyzing datasets
Employer & Industry UsageBusinesses, consulting firms, marketing agenciesTech companies, research firms, finance, and healthcare sectors

Weekend Business Analytics and Weekend Data Analysis share similar educational backgrounds and work environments. However, Business Analytics emphasizes strategic decision-making and business insights, while Data Analysis focuses more on technical data processing and statistical analysis. Both roles are in demand across various industries, often overlapping in skills and tools used.

As a Business Analytics Lead within PNC's Technology organization, you will be based in Pittsburgh, PA, Cleveland, OH, Birmingham, AL, Dallas, TX or Denver, CO.
The ServiceNow IT Asset Management (ITAM) & CMDB Business Analytics Lead is responsible for driving the governance, quality, analytics, and continuous improvement of IT asset and configuration data. This role serves as the strategic liaison between technology, operations, asset management, architecture, and business stakeholders to ensure accurate, reliable, and actionable data across the IT ecosystem.
Key Responsibilities:
Lead CMDB and ITAM data governance initiatives to ensure data quality, integrity, compliance, and operational effectiveness.
Develop and maintain executive dashboards, KPIs, scorecards, and performance analytics related to asset management, CMDB health, discovery coverage, and service mapping.
Partner with asset owners, configuration item (CI) owners, infrastructure teams, procurement, risk, and enterprise architecture to improve data quality and lifecycle management processes.
Analyze trends, identify risks, and provide actionable insights that improve asset visibility, compliance, service reliability, and operational efficiency.
Support CMDB certification, audit readiness, reconciliation activities, and compliance requirements through ongoing monitoring and remediation efforts.
Drive adoption of CMDB, CSDM, Discovery, Service Mapping, Hardware Asset Management (HAM), and Software Asset Management (SAM) capabilities.
Translate complex technical data into meaningful business insights and executive-level reporting to support strategic decision-making.
Identify automation and process improvement opportunities that enhance data accuracy, reduce manual effort, and increase operational maturity
Qualifications:
Experience with IT Asset Management, CMDB, ITSM, ITOM, ServiceNow, and CSDM frameworks.
Strong analytical, reporting, and data governance skills.
Experience developing KPIs, dashboards, and executive-level reporting.
Ability to lead cross-functional initiatives and influence stakeholders across technology and business organizations.
